Town museum presenting archaeology, local history, and artworks that explain Frascati’s past from antiquity to modern times.
Archaeological museum focused on the Tusculum territory, with finds that illuminate ancient settlement around Frascati and the Alban Hills.
Modern exhibition venue inside the Scuderie complex, hosting rotating art, photography, and cultural shows in a central historic setting.
Frascati’s main square, framed by the cathedral and civic buildings; a natural starting point for exploring the historic center.
Popular pedestrian area and lookout edge near the center, offering pleasant walks and a sense of Frascati’s hillside setting.
Green public park with shaded paths and relaxation areas, favored by locals for easy walks close to the town center.
Crisp, mineral white wine from the Frascati DOC/DOCG hills. It is the town’s signature drink and a classic pairing with Roman and Castelli Romani cooking.
Small porchetta sandwiches or slices of herb-roasted pork, common across the Castelli Romani. A beloved local street and tavern staple.
Rustic pasta with guanciale, pecorino and black pepper. Deeply tied to Roman cuisine and widely eaten in Frascati’s traditional trattorias.

Moderate for Lazio day trips: dining is cheaper than central Rome, transit is low-cost, and hotels are limited but often better value than big-city stays.
Service is often included or modest. Round up or leave €1-2 in cafes, 5-10% at restaurants for good service, and round up taxi fares.
